Reversed Meaning

General

The Sun reversed usually points to Temporary setbacks or delayed success. Stay optimistic, clouds will clear.. In love it often suggests Minor issues in relationship or lack of enthusiasm., while in work and practical decisions it tends to show Delayed success or temporary difficulties..

Temporary setbacks or delayed success. Stay optimistic, clouds will clear.

Love

Minor issues in relationship or lack of enthusiasm.

Career

Delayed success or temporary difficulties.

Keywords

Delay, Setbacks, Lack of enthusiasm, Clouds
